🖐 attrs by Example — attrs 19.3.0 documentation

Most Liked Casino Bonuses in the last 7 days 🎰

Filter:
Sort:
B6655644
Bonus:
Free Spins
Players:
All
WR:
50 xB
Max cash out:
$ 200

__slots__ aren't perfect * If you misspell __slots__, there is typically no indication that it's not working * Subclasses need to add their own�...


Enjoy!
Saving 9 GB of RAM with Python's __slots__ | Hacker News
Valid for casinos
Reddit - learnpython - __slots__ Usage
Visits
Dislikes
Comments
__slots__ in python 3

CODE5637
Bonus:
Free Spins
Players:
All
WR:
50 xB
Max cash out:
$ 500

Python has an intriguing feature called "slots".. class B(object): __slots__ = ['b'] b = B() b.b = 3 b.a = 1 # => raises an AttributeError b.__dict__�...


Enjoy!
Use of __slots__ in Python Class – PyBloggers
Valid for casinos
Idiomatic Python Take 3: new-style classes — Intermediate and Advanced Software Carpentry 1.0 documentation
Visits
Dislikes
Comments
Basically, I'd like to use slots whenever possible, but older versions of the typing module do not support slots in generic classes due to a.
Is it okay to use the switch from the code design remarkable, casinos ohne einzahlung bonus think />I've never seen it before, that's why I'm wondering.
On the one hand, this both works and does what it says it does.
So you're already ahead of a substantial amount of real-world code on that front.
On the other hand, are you going to add extra branches like this for every bug they fix in Python?
It's probably not worth it, frankly.
Most users who are running 3.
If someone complains that your code does not run on 3.
If you do not want to field those complaints in the first place, you can add a version check at your program's entry point and fail-fast there with a sensible error message.
Given that some distributors may be manually backporting fixes to old versions of Python, this may or may not be an ideal design decision, depending on your target audience and platform for example, Windows users will typically be using a "stock" version of Python, while Linux users are more likely to get Python from their distro's package repository.
In most cases, you don't.
In most of the cases where you do need it, you can't just yank it out to work around a bug.
On the fourth hand, based on the name of your class and its variables, you appear to be re-implementing rangewhich.
What really confuses me, though, is this data variable.
It looks like you are trying to bundle a range together with some arbitrary __slots__ in python 3 />If so, you probably want composition rather than inheritance.
But either way, that's a poor choice of name.
EliKorvigo: Only you can evaluate your precise situation and target audience, but I would encourage you to carefully consider the distribution of responsibility.
It sounds like you are saying __slots__ in python 3 1 you are responsible for making your software work on the customer's system, but 2 you are not allowed to update Python on the customer's system, evenand yet __slots__ in python 3 the customer is not a Python 2.
If all those are true, you have my sympathy.
That attribute was added to store annotation this objects are supposed to live in an AVL-tree, representing annotation.
For example, telling people to upgrade from 3.
In that case I'd do something like: assert sys.
Provide details and share your research!
To learn more, see our.

JK644W564
Bonus:
Free Spins
Players:
All
WR:
60 xB
Max cash out:
$ 500

You would want to use __slots__ if you are going to instantiate a lot (hundreds, thousands) of objects of the. Python class without __slots__.


Enjoy!
The Python I Would Like To See | Armin Ronacher's Thoughts and Writings
Valid for casinos
Automatically generate __slots__ attribute for classes and assign attributes on instances « Python recipes « ActiveState Code
Visits
Dislikes
Comments
How To Use Functions In Python (Python Tutorial #3)

🎰 YouTube

Software - MORE
B6655644
Bonus:
Free Spins
Players:
All
WR:
30 xB
Max cash out:
$ 1000

As shown, the generated __init__ method allows for both positional and.. When using attrs on Python 3, you can also add keyword-only attributes:... Defining __slots__ by hand is tedious, in attrs it's just a matter of passing slots=True :.


Enjoy!
Idiomatic Python Take 3: new-style classes — Intermediate and Advanced Software Carpentry 1.0 documentation
Valid for casinos
The Python I Would Like To See | Armin Ronacher's Thoughts and Writings
Visits
Dislikes
Comments
__slots__ in python 3

B6655644
Bonus:
Free Spins
Players:
All
WR:
50 xB
Max cash out:
$ 200

Per the Python 3 docs (for some reason not in the Python 2 docs, but the same. PyPy does the same thing as using __slots__ on CPython�...


Enjoy!
Python Slots | David Wyde
Valid for casinos
Idiomatic Python Take 3: new-style classes — Intermediate and Advanced Software Carpentry 1.0 documentation
Visits
Dislikes
Comments
__slots__ in python 3

A7684562
Bonus:
Free Spins
Players:
All
WR:
50 xB
Max cash out:
$ 1000

Property Descriptor; Using descriptor methods __get__ and __set__; Using slots (only restricts setting. Python ships with built in function called property.... 3. 4. 5. 6. 7. 8. 9. 10. >>> class Foo(object):. __slots__ = 'a', 'b'.


Enjoy!
YouTube
Valid for casinos
python - Dynamically choose whether to use __slots__ in a class - Software Engineering Stack Exchange
Visits
Dislikes
Comments
__slots__ in python 3

G66YY644
Bonus:
Free Spins
Players:
All
WR:
30 xB
Max cash out:
$ 200

The proper use of __slots__ is to save space in objects. Instead of having a dynamic dict that allows adding attributes to objects at anytime, there is a static structure which does not allow additions after creation. [This use of __slots__ eliminates the overhead of one dict for every object.]


Enjoy!
attrs by Example — attrs 19.3.0 documentation
Valid for casinos
python - Dynamically choose whether to use __slots__ in a class - Software Engineering Stack Exchange
Visits
Dislikes
Comments
__slots__ in python 3

CODE5637
Bonus:
Free Spins
Players:
All
WR:
50 xB
Max cash out:
$ 200

When you declare instance variables using __slots__, Python creates a descriptor object as a class variable with the same name. In your case�...


Enjoy!
Using __slots__
Valid for casinos
Saving 9 GB of RAM with Python's __slots__ | Hacker News
Visits
Dislikes
Comments
__slots__ in python 3

B6655644
Bonus:
Free Spins
Players:
All
WR:
50 xB
Max cash out:
$ 1000

This gem is special; it isn't about readability or decreasing length of a program. It's actually about performance. At the heart of every class is a dict that contains�...


Enjoy!
The magic behind Attribute Access in Python – Sachin Joglekar's blog
Valid for casinos
python - Dynamically choose whether to use __slots__ in a class - Software Engineering Stack Exchange
Visits
Dislikes
Comments
__slots__ in python 3

JK644W564
Bonus:
Free Spins
Players:
All
WR:
30 xB
Max cash out:
$ 500

Python Classes, namedtuples and __slots__. April 29 - 2018. Python. Recently, PEP 557 (Data Classes) was accepted, however, it won't appear until Python 3.7. In this Blog Post we will explore what.. created[i] = dataclass(1, 2, 3). if (i + 1)�...


Enjoy!
Saving 9 GB of RAM with Python's __slots__ | Hacker News
Valid for casinos
dataslots � PyPI
Visits
Dislikes
Comments
Python slots inheritance/subclassing, caveats, getting pickle to work with slots, pickling protocols